Output afbaa73b1a311dfaf24684e3bbc7c9fea78e3d3d92e3fe9ad21a0072d7749f55:6

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 b8b221ae346a8e944ff44c2da0be33429cef0663
address
bc1qhzezrt35d28fgnl5fsk6p03ng2ww7pnrulg5jk
transaction
afbaa73b1a311dfaf24684e3bbc7c9fea78e3d3d92e3fe9ad21a0072d7749f55
confirmations
186020
spent
false

2 Sat Ranges